Plant biotechnology is a means to artificially improve or modify existing plants and animals. It uses scientific processes to make changes to the genetic material Deoxyribonucleic acid (DNA).
Genetic engineering involves the use of recombinant DNA technology, a process by which a DNA sequence is manipulated in vitro, to create recombinant DNA molecules with new combinations of genetic material. The recombinant DNA is then introduced into a host organism, resulting in genetically modified organisms (GMOs) with desirable traits, such as resistance to pests or increased nutritional value.
If the foreign DNA that is introduced comes from a different species, the host organism can be considered transgenic, which is particularly common in agricultural applications to enhance crop production and sustainability.
